Liberty football season ticket ads may be seen on various TV channels, such as ABC 13 WSET, as well as cable channels including BET, Discovery, ESPN, ESPN2, Fox News, FX, Lifetime and Nickelodeon. Liberty also has an ad running on Comcast Spotlight as a cable sponsor of the 2008 Olympic Games in Beijing. Over 1,500 spots will be seen locally during the next three weeks. You may view the various television ads by clicking the video links above.

The ads are generated to attract new season ticket holders, as well as those who need to be reminded to renew their seats from last year. Season ticket sales for the 2008 campaign have already passed 1,100, a mark which is twice as many as were sold at this time last year. Sales are on track to set another record for total season tickets, which would mark the third year in a row.
